About Garteiser Honea
Garteiser Honea is a litigation boutique dedicated to winning high-stakes trials and appeals in courts across the country. We handle complex intellectual-property and business disputes as lead counsel.

What Is the Cost of Living Near San Francisco?

Understanding the cost of living near San Francisco is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Garteiser Honea.
San Francisco's Cost of Living Index is approximately 243.5 (143.5% more expensive than US average; 74.2% more than CA average). One of the most expensive cities globally, extreme housing costs, high transportation, and very high prices for all goods/services. When planning your budget based on a salary from Garteiser Honea,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$3,200 - $5,000+ A significant portion of Garteiser Honea sal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$200 - $320 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$81 (Muni Monthly Pass 'M')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$550 - $850 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$600 - $1,200+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$450 - $850+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$5,081 - $8,221+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
